Trainingsession 12/4/10-18/4/10

More training from Portugal. There was some easing down for the 12 stage but it was pretty pointless in the end.

Monday- am: 42 mins with Steve.

                pm: 37 mins easy with Steve.

Tuesday- am: Track session with Steve of 8x400m off 200 jog in 45s then a few 200's. Times were 65, 66, 66, 65, 65, 65, 66, 65 then 28, 27, 27. Felt great in the session and the 200's felt pretty comfortable. The end of the 400's was tough but that's because of the nature of the recovery.

                 pm: 23 mins easy with Steve and Maria.

Wednesday- 34 mins easy with Steve and Maria, felt fine.

Thursday- 20 mins easy with Steve and Maria then the interview with Tom Gayle. After the interview did another 20 mins easy back to the hotel with a few strides in there, legs felt good.

Friday- Early start to the airport for our flight but ended up being cancelled. We were pretty pissed off so was just going to have a rest day but ended up going out for 50 mins.

Saturday- Track session with Steve and Nick McCormick. Session was 3x800m in 2:07/2:08 off 2:30 lap jog then 4x400m off 200 jog in 60-62. Times were 2:08, 2:06, 2:07, 60, 61, 59, 60. Brilliant session and surprising how easy those times felt. It was hard work but running those reps didn't feel as hard as I thought. The 400's didn't feel very fast whereas last year a 60 felt like a sprint. I even finished the 800's considering whether or not I could hold that pace for 7 and a half laps straight off...?

Sunday- am: 97 mins with Steve. Those who read my training regularly will realise this is way above what I normally do and I think it's 20 mins longer than my longest run ever, so I have a new PB for longest amount of time running. We didn't mean to be out this long but we got lost. Still, I got through the run fine and my legs felt ok going into the 90 min zone. I was very proud of myself afterwards.

            pm: Core and prehab exercises with Maria

62 mile week
